Kevin Ryde <address@hidden> writes:
> Speaking of SCM_STRING_LENGTH, things like that which have been macros
> in the past should remain as macros, not functions, even if all it
> does is a function call.
>
> Changing from macro to function for instance broke guile-gtk. It was
> #ifdef testing for SCM_STRING_LENGTH to know to use that (in 1.6), as
> opposed to SCM_LENGTH (in whatever dim dark past).
Yes, you are right! Thanks for reminding me, I will go thru all
deprecated things and make sure that macros stay macros.
